If you have twins or children very similar in age, a tandem double buggy is a fantastic option. They're narrower than side-by-side buggies and ideal for navigating tight spaces such as doors, on public transport and rocky terrain.

Some are able to be converted into travel systems that can take two carrycots or car seats for children. However, they are heavier and longer than single pushchairs, and may not be as stable when as they bump up the kerbs.

Convertible

Whether you're looking for a convertible stroller that can be converted from a single and double stroller to a double or to add an additional seat to an existing one, there are several options available. The UPPAbaby V2 is spacious, gorgeous stroller. It is easily transformed from a single stroller to a dual by adding the Rumble seat. It's costly and less mobile than other double strollers since the second seat is placed behind the front seat. The Nuna Demi Grow is a similar model with great seating versatility but lacks under-seat storage when used in doubles mode.

Other options include all-terrain twin buggies, as well as fixed-wheel joggers that can hold two children. They are more expensive, but they are designed for long-distance trips over rough terrain and have more expensive resales.

Reclining seat recline independently

If you are looking for a double stroller which can accommodate children of various age groups, you'll require one with a recliner that is independent for both seats. This allows your child of a higher age to relax in the back while the baby sleeps in the bassinet, and reverse.

Consider the width of your pushchair and consider how easy it is for you to get through doors and public transportation. If you have narrow doorways then it might be worth considering a side-by-side pushchair, such as the Mountain Buggy Duet which has the benefit of having a footprint similar to a single buggy but can still accommodate two seats and car seat adaptors.

Tandem buggies are generally larger than side-by-side models, which makes them more difficult to maneuver up and down kerbs. However they can be able to accommodate more combinations of seats/carrycots/car seats and are the perfect choice for twins and siblings of different ages. They can also be more expensive than single-to double buggies, but are worth the purchase if you plan to keep it for a long time and will have a decent amount of resale value should you sell it on when your children are out of it.

Another crucial thing to look for is whether the seat backs are able to recline independently of each other as this will let you put your child in the ideal position for naps or watching. This is especially important if you have a younger child in the rear seat who may be inclined to lie down and take a snooze while the more mature child wants to sit up and look around their surroundings.

Certain brands have a unique design that allows the back of their vehicles to recline into a position that is almost flat, ideal for babies. For instance, the iCandy Orange has raised stadium-style seating and can recline both the toddler seat included and the additional RumbleSeat into multiple positions so that your children have a the option of deciding where to sit, as well as offering an excellent UPF 50+ canopy that has peekaboo windows.

Larger than twin buggies

They are great for siblings of different age groups, and you can move around without having to worry about your children touching. They're usually a bit larger with one seat placed behind the other and offering a fully-flat recline for newborns (or a more upright position for toddlers).

A popular option is the Mountain Buggy Duet, which is the tiniest side-by-side model available and has the same footprint as one buggy. It has an adjustable handle that makes it easier for parents to push and a handbrake that can be useful on hills that are steep. It is suitable for use right from birth, and can be paired with a range of car seats and carrycots.

The iCandy Wave is another option. It can be folded in mono or duo mode in a single click. The clever frame expands in width to accommodate an additional chair and can be used up to two car seats or carrycots. This makes it a great choice for older siblings that would like to sit together. It's slightly larger than other models, but it still feels light and has a comfortable suspension for curbs.

There are also plenty of 3-wheeler inline tandems available - check out Phil and Teds inline models or iCandy's Peach and Pear buggies for instance - which offer stability and swift steering. These can often be folded into one buggy if you have limited space at home or need to transport it from your car to the bus stop.
